Common use of Authorization and Validity of the Notes Clause in Contracts

Authorization and Validity of the Notes. The Notes have been duly authorized for issuance and sale pursuant to this Agreement and, when issued, authenticated and delivered pursuant to the provisions of this Agreement and the Indenture against payment of the consideration therefor specified in this Agreement, will constitute valid and legally binding obligations of the Company enforceable in accordance with their terms, except as enforcement thereof may be limited by bankruptcy, insolvency, reorganization or other laws relating to or affecting creditors’ rights generally or by general principles of equity (regardless of whether such enforceability is considered in a proceeding in equity or at law); the Notes and the Indenture conform in all material respects to all statements relating thereto contained in the Prospectus; and the Notes will be entitled to the benefits provided by the Indenture.
